construction works related to Polavaram Multipurpose Project. Informing the media in New Delhi the Union Minister for Environment, Forest and Climate Change Shri Prakash Javadekar said that today the order has been signed and ministry has allowed the construction works for two years. 

The Union Minister stressed that Polavaram project is very important to the people of Andhra Pradesh as it will irrigate nearly 3 lakh ha of land, generate hydel power with installed capacity of 960 MW and provide drinking water facilities to 540 enroute villages covering 25 lakh populations, particularly in Visakhapatnam, East Godavari and West Godavari and Krishna Districts.


Two day Meeting of Expert Working Group of Paris Pact Initiative of UNODC to be held in New Delhi on 27th and 28th June, 2019; Will provide an opportunity for Indian Agencies to understand the Updates on current threats posed by Illicit Financial Flows

The Department of Revenue, Ministry of Finance is hosting a Meeting of Expert Working Group on Paris Pact Initiative on Illicit Financial Flows deriving from the trafficking of Opiates originating in Afghanistan. The Meeting consists of Sessions spread over two days on 27th and 28th  June, 2019 and is being organised with the support of United Nations Office on Drugs & Crimes (UNODC). The Meeting will be inaugurated by the Additional Secretary, Revenue Mr. Anil Kumar Jha and will be attended by the representatives of the Member Countries of Paris Pact, Regional Representatives of UNODC and Senior Officers of the Indian agencies like DRI, ED and NCB involved in countering the money laundering/illicit financial flows related to drug trafficking.

NTPC-PGCIL joint venture to focus on improving efficiency of distribution utilities

National Electricity Distribution Company Ltd (NEDCL) — the newly- formed 50:50 joint venture between NTPC and PowerGrid Corporation of India Ltd (PGCIL) — will enter the electricity distribution business on a pan-India basis.

But, it will not become a distribution utility (DISCOM) like Tamil Nadu Generation & Distribution Corporation Ltd or Bangalore Electricity Supply Company Ltd. Instead this joint venture will have a character similar to other such ventures such as Energy Efficiency Services Ltd and Petronet LNG that operate as profit-focussed entities


NITI Aayog CEO Amitabh Kant gets two-year extension

The Appointments Committee of Cabinet has extended the tenure of NITI Aayog’s Chief Executive Officer, Amitabh Kant, by another two years.

He was appointed as the CEO of the government think-tank on February 17, 2016, for a fixed two-year term.

Kant was later given an extension till June 30, 2019. His term will now come to an end on June 30, 2021.

A Kerala-cadre Indian Administrative Service (IAS) officer of the 1980 batch, his last posting before taking charge as the NITI Aayog CEO was the Secretary, Department of Industrial Policy and Promotion.



 K Natarajan to be the new director general of Indian Coast Guard

Krishnaswamy Natarajan appointed as the next director general of Indian Coast Guard.  He replaces Rajendra Singh who is retiring after three and a half years of service. K. Natarajan joined the Coast Guard on January 18, 1984. He holds a Masters Degree in Defence and Strategic Studies from Madras University. He held various important command and staff appointments, both afloat and ashore. The flag officer commanded all classes of ICG ships namely Advanced Offshore Patrol Vessel (AOPV) Sangram, Offshore Patrol Vessel (OPV) Veera, Fast Patrol Vessel (FPV) Kanaklata Barua and Inshore Patrol Vessel (IPV) Chandbibi.

Max Bupa partners with MobiKwik for health insurance

Max Bupa, a standalone health insurer entered into a strategic partnership with MobiKwik, a fintech platform to promote affordable and convenient bite-sized group health insurance products for MobiKwik’s 107 Million customers across the country. Max Bupa come up with a slew of innovative offerings, including a Cancer cover at a nominal premium  A HospiCash product for MobiKwik’s vast customer base.
Max Bupa’s HospiCash product provides for a pre-defined daily allowance on the basis of number of days of hospitalisation irrespective of the actual expense incurred by the customer. HospiCash will offer ₹500 per day hospital allowance for up to 30 days in a year.


Lok Sabha passed the Special Economic Zones (Amendment) Bill, 2019

The Lok Sabha passed the Special Economic Zones (Amendment) Bill, 2019 on 26 June. The amendment of sub-section (v) of Section 2 of the SEZ Act, 2005 will make a trust or any entity notified by the Central government eligible for consideration of grant of permission to set up a unit in special economic zones. The Bill aims at improving and encouraging more investments and introducing features including single-window clearance and to ease imports and exports.


MoRTH plans to introduce Universal smart card driving licences to curb fake or bogus licenses

The government plans to introduce Universal smart card driving licences. The Ministry of Road Transport and Highways (MoRTH) has decided to modify the current format of driving licenses. It aims to curb fake or bogus licenses. 

Smart card driving licences:
The smart card driving licences will be a laminated card without chip or smart card type driving licences and which will include nationwide standardised format of placement of Information, standardization of fonts etc. All of the information of an individual is stored electronically. The biometric data of an individual is computerised and can be accessed by RTOs / ARTOs via their office servers. For this purpose, RTOs (Regional Transport Offices) should issue a uniform format of driving licenses across nation. The biometric data provided by the applicant will include details such as blood group, a scan on their retina, fingerprints and body marks, etc. This information will be stored in the RTO / ARTO office server and will also be sent to the head office of each state’s transport department.


Malayalam film 'Veyilmarangal' won an award at Shanghai International film festival

At the 22nd Shanghai International Film Festival, Director Bijukumar Damodaran received the Outstanding Artistic Achievement Award for the film, Veyil Marangal (Trees Under the Sun).
This is for the first Indian film to win a major award at the festival.
The film is one among the 3,964 entries submitted from 112 countries in the prestigious Golden Goblet Award competition.  The jury chairperson at the Fest was the Turkish director Nuri Bilge Ceylan.

RBI launched Complaint Management System to facilitate grievance redressal process

The Reserve Bank of India (RBI) has launched Complaint Management System (CMS), on its website for facilitating RBI's grievance redressal process and also to improve customer experience in timely redressal of grievances.

Complaint Management System (CMS):
CMS is a software application launched by RBI for lodging complaints against any regulated entity with public interface such as commercial banks, urban cooperative banks (UCBs), Non-Banking Financial Companies (NBFCs). CMS is also provided with various dashboards which will help RBI to effectively track progress in redressal of complaints.
